Datos clave
- Categoría
- Math & Numbers
- Tipos de entrada
- text, number
- Tipo de salida
- json
- Cobertura de muestras
- 4
- API disponible
- Yes
Resumen
Convierte valores de bytes a megabytes (MB) usando el estándar decimal donde 1 MB = 1,000,000 bytes. Ideal para interpretar tamaños de archivo crudos desde logs, APIs o bases de datos, con precisión decimal configurable según tus necesidades de reporte.
Cuándo usarlo
- •Cuando necesitas interpretar tamaños de archivo en bytes provenientes de logs de sistema o respuestas de API.
- •Al preparar reportes de almacenamiento donde los valores deben mostrarse en MB con precisión específica.
- •Para validar límites de carga de archivos convirtiendo bytes a MB antes de procesar datos.
Cómo funciona
- •Ingresa el valor numérico en bytes en el campo correspondiente.
- •Especifica la cantidad de decimales deseada entre 0 y 10 (4 por defecto).
- •La herramienta aplica la conversión decimal estándar dividiendo entre 1,000,000.
- •Obtienes un objeto JSON con el valor original en bytes y el resultado en megabytes.
Casos de uso
Ejemplos
1. Validación de límite de carga
Desarrollador Frontend- Contexto
- Un desarrollador recibe el tamaño de archivos seleccionados por usuarios en bytes desde la API del navegador y debe validar contra un límite de 5 MB antes de enviar al servidor.
- Problema
- Necesita convertir bytes a MB con 2 decimales para comparar rápidamente con el límite permitido.
- Cómo usarlo
- Ingresa el valor en bytes (por ejemplo, 5242880) y establece la precisión decimal en 2.
- Configuración de ejemplo
-
{"precision": 2} - Resultado
- Obtiene 5.24 MB, valida que excede el límite de 5.00 MB y muestra error al usuario antes de iniciar la carga.
2. Normalización de métricas de almacenamiento
Ingeniero de Datos- Contexto
- Un ingeniero procesa logs de servidores que registran uso de disco en bytes y necesita alimentar un dashboard que muestra consumo en MB.
- Problema
- Los stakeholders requieren ver los valores en MB con 4 decimales para análisis detallado de capacidad.
- Cómo usarlo
- Introduce los valores crudos en bytes desde los logs y mantiene la precisión predeterminada de 4 decimales.
- Resultado
- Genera datos consistentes en MB para visualización en herramientas de BI y reportes de capacidad.
Probar con muestras
math-&-numbersHubs relacionados
Preguntas frecuentes
¿Qué estándar utiliza esta conversión?
Usa el estándar decimal donde 1 MB = 1,000,000 bytes, no el estándar binario (MiB).
¿Cuál es la precisión máxima permitida?
Puedes configurar hasta 10 decimales; el valor predeterminado es 4.
¿El campo de bytes acepta separadores de miles?
No, ingresa el número entero sin puntos ni comas; por ejemplo, 10485760.
¿El resultado incluye unidades de texto?
No, el JSON devuelve valores numéricos puros que puedes formatear según necesites.
¿Funciona con números muy grandes?
Sí, procesa valores enteros grandes típicos de sistemas de almacenamiento modernos.